About 709 4th St
How much is 709 4th St, Friend, NE worth?
The TopHap Estimate for 709 4th St, Friend, NE is $184,493 as of Aug 30, 2026. The likely range is $158,605 to $210,381. The estimate is modelled from recorded sales, assessments and the property's own characteristics — it is not an appraisal.
When did 709 4th St, Friend, NE last sell?
709 4th St, Friend, NE last sold on Jun 18, 2024 for $186,000, according to the county's recorded deed.
How big is 709 4th St, Friend, NE?
709 4th St, Friend, NE has 2 bedrooms, 3 bathrooms, 1,386 square feet of living space and a 0.26-acre lot.
When was 709 4th St, Friend, NE built?
709 4th St, Friend, NE was built in 1959, making it 67 years old. The building has 1 story.
What schools serve 709 4th St, Friend, NE?
709 4th St, Friend, NE is assigned to Friend High Schools (middle), rated C; Friend Elementary School (elementary), rated A. All sit in Friend Public Schools. Attendance boundaries change — confirm with the district before relying on an assignment.
How does 709 4th St, Friend, NE compare to other homes in Friend 68359?
Among the 657 homes in Friend 68359, it is worth more than 47% of them ($184,493 against a typical $197,415), its price per square foot is higher than 54% of them ($133 against a typical $130), it is bigger than 37% of them (1,386 ft² against a typical 1,548 ft²), its lot is bigger than 25% of them (0.26 ac against a typical 0.34 ac) and it is newer than 58% of them (1959 against a typical 1943). Measured against all of Saline County, it is worth more than 41% of homes there. These shares are recounted nightly from the full county assessor record for each area, not from active listings.
What are the property taxes on 709 4th St, Friend, NE?
The 2025 property tax bill for 709 4th St, Friend, NE was $2,525. The county assessed it at $172,340.
